I've long wanted to see a tree-swift.
At Danum Valley I finally found them - and not just found them but got so close. What handsome birds!
This guy was perched on the swing bridge over Sungai (River) Segama.
From this perch it would search for prey (small flying insects) then launch out in pursuit; quite different behaviour to that of 'normal' swifts and swiftlets that hawk constantly like swallows.
Tree-swifts are not closely related to swifts.
